Output d4a7aad5d21e970a2a7bbec6c23932fcb68a63a7b5cf00680b4e968ca7cc64a3:0

value
129705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012fba510cfea8435d02ec5af7e7c983b5a06524 OP_EQUAL
address
31oHmvPD8wiEhiWoR3p6duRuGxGuBhJZdV
transaction
d4a7aad5d21e970a2a7bbec6c23932fcb68a63a7b5cf00680b4e968ca7cc64a3
confirmations
217206
spent
true